Abstract:
Let $\operatorname {aut}(X)$ be the group of homotopy classes of self-homotopy equivalences of a space $X$ and let $[f] \in [X,Y]$ be a homotopy class of maps from $X$ to $Y$ . The aim of this paper is to prove that under certain nilpotency and finiteness conditions the isotropy group $\operatorname {aut}{(X)_{[f]}}$ of $[f]$ under the action of $\operatorname {aut}(X)$ on $[X,Y]$ is commensurable to an arithmetic group. Therefore $\operatorname {aut}{(X)_{[f]}}$ is a finitely presented group by a result of Borel and Harish-Chandra.References
